You need 2 of the left, the bevel goes against the axle.
The swing hardware changed over the years, there is also 3 different lengths of axles and tubes.
Just for shits and giggles check to see if both sides are the same length.

Joe if you plan on servicing VW beetles get the 1966-1970 bentley manual as it covers both swing and IRS standard trans, plus autostick trannies.
Servicing beetles you can get away with just this one manual and the net.
I'd also get the Bentley transporter and vanagon manuals
All other aftermarket manuals suck.

On the VW part numbers:
A VW Type may not have the part numbers for the specific type of car.
So if a regular type one number (111,113) fits a type 2 bus they don't change the part number.
But then if a type 3 part is used on a later beetle improvement then the type1 beetle will have a part with a type 3 part number on it.
Example a VW T1 superbeetle front wheel cylinder is part #361-611-067-A, the number starts with 3 because it was originally a T3 rear wheel cylinder.
